11问答网
所有问题
当前搜索:
float能保留到小数点后几位
float
精度
到多少位
?
答:
后面6位小数
。精度主要取决于尾数部分的位数。对于float32(单精度)来说,表示尾数的为23位,除去全部为0的情况以外,最小为2-23,约等于1.19*10-7,所以float小数部分只能精确到后面6位,加上小数点前的一位,即有效数字为7位。同理float64(单精度)的尾数部分为52位,最小为2-52,约为2.2...
float
精确
到多少位小数
呢?
答:
float精确到七位小数
。float和double的精度是由尾数的位数来决定的。浮点数在内存中是按科学计数法来存储的,其整数部分始终是一个隐含着的“1”,因为它是不变的,故不能对精度造成影响。float:2^23 = 8388608,一共七位,这意味着最多能有7位有效数字,但绝对能保证的为
6位
,也即float的精度为...
float
类型数字
保留几位小数点后面
的数字?
答:
在C语言中,
float类型的数据默认保留小数点后6位
,不足6位的以0补齐,超过6位按四舍五入截断。最多能保留7位有效数字,能绝对保证6位有效数字。详细可参考博文:网页链接 照片中的2.0其实就是2.000000,3.0其实就是3.000000,float类型的默认保留小数点后6位;100/40结果应该是2.5,书中的2....
float
到底
能保留几位小数
?
答:
float对应的是6位小数
,如果输出语句不做额外定义就输出带有6位小数。
float精度是2^23,能保证6位
。double精度是2^52,能保证15位。但是默认float和double都只能显示6位,再多需要#include <iomanip>,然后在输出语句之前插入cout << setprecision(20);强制输出小数位。
float
类型
保留几位小数
答:
float类型默认保留小数点后6位
,若是要输出一位或者其他位数,可以按照以下形式进行输出:printf("%.(这里输入要输出的位数)f",x);如输出一位:printf("%.1f",x);
float
输出默认
几位小数
答:
float 为单精度,有效数字为6~7double 为双精度,有效数字为15~16 但他们在输出时,小数点后都有
6位
小数。
float
默认
保留几位小数
答:
1. 通常情况下,编程语言中的浮点数(
float
)会默认
保留
两位
小数
。2. 这一默认设置满足了大多数科学计算和数据处理的精度需求。3. 然而,根据不同的编程语言和具体应用场景,小数的保留位数可能会有所不同。4. 在需要更高精度的情况下,可以选择使用双精度浮点数(double)或其他更高精度的数据类型。
float
默认
保留几位小数
答:
在大多数编程语言中,浮点数(
float
)通常默认保留两位小数。这是因为大多数科学计算和数据处理通常只需要两位
小数就能
满足精度要求。然而,具体
保留几位小数
还取决于具体的编程语言和上下文。在某些情况下,可能需要更多的精度,这时可能需要使用更高精度的数据类型,如双精度浮点数(double)或更高精度的数据...
float
是
小数点后几位
?
答:
单精度浮点型
小数点后面
有效数字为7位和双精度浮点型小数点后面有效数字为16位。单精度在一些处理器上比双精度更快而且只占用双精度一半的空间,但是当值很大或很小的时候,它将变得不精确。当需要小数部分并且对精度的要求不高时,单精度浮点型的变量是有用的。例如,当表示美元和分时,单精度浮点型是...
c语言
float
和double
保留小数点后几位
答:
c语言float和double保留小数点后
6位
。C语言中,输出double类型(双精度实型)以及float类型(单精度实型)时,默认输出6位小数(不足六位以0补齐,超过六位按四舍五入截断)。如果想小数点后面16位,写成%.16lf,不会自动四舍五入的,double是一个近似值,通常没有办法做的很精确。通常能精确到小数点...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
float小数到几位的正确写法
float类型精度为多少位
输出float型保留几位小数
float类型小数点后有多少位
float默认精确到几位小数
float定义的小数最多几位
float32小数点后多少位
float多少位存小数
float保留几位有效数字